What is Pin Generator?
Pin Generator is a Pinterest‑focused marketing automation platform that helps users create and schedule large volumes of Pinterest pins from multiple sources such as websites, sitemaps, RSS feeds, CSV files, and connected eCommerce stores like Etsy and Shopify. The tool pulls images and SEO‑optimized metadata from your content, then applies customizable templates to generate visually consistent pins that align with your brand. It is designed for bloggers, affiliate marketers, Etsy and Shopify sellers, and content creators who want to scale Pinterest traffic without spending hours on manual pin design.
Key features include a template builder for custom pin layouts, AI‑assisted title and description generation, bulk pin editing, and smart scheduling that distributes pins over time across multiple boards. The platform also offers integrations with WordPress, Shopify, and Etsy, plus a keyword research tool and trend alerts to help you optimize pin topics and timing. With a focus on bulk workflows, you can generate hundreds of pins from a single URL or sitemap and maintain a steady publishing cadence on Pinterest.
Pin Generator is ideal for users who already use Pinterest for content discovery, affiliate links, or product promotion and want to automate repetitive design and scheduling tasks. It suits solo entrepreneurs, small‑business owners, and agencies that manage multiple Pinterest accounts or campaigns. Because it supports RSS and sitemap inputs, it is especially useful for bloggers and content heavy sites looking to turn existing articles into a library of Pinterest‑ready pins without redesigning each one from scratch.
Pin Generator pricing
Pricing model: Paid
Pin Generator offers a free tier with a limited number of monthly pin credits, plus several paid plans that scale by credits and features. The main paid tiers include Starter, Pro, and Agency plans billed monthly or annually with discounts for yearly subscriptions; each plan increases the monthly pin credits, maintains unlimited connected Pinterest profiles, and unlocks capabilities such as advanced scheduling, keyword research, and priority support. All paid plans include the template builder, AI writer, and integrations with WordPress, Shopify, Etsy, and other sources, with the highest‑tier plan providing the largest credit pool and agency‑level features for managing multiple clients or brands.

Frequently asked questions about Pin Generator
How does Pin Generator create pins from my website?
Pin Generator scans your website or sitemap, extracts article titles, descriptions, images, and metadata, then plugs that content into your chosen pin templates to generate multiple pins per page. You can adjust which images and text fields are used, regenerate variations, and apply brand‑specific fonts and colors across all pins to keep them consistent with your visual identity.
What are pin credits and how do they work?
Pin credits are the internal currency used to generate pins and run certain automation features; each generated pin consumes one or more credits depending on the method and settings. The platform tracks your credit usage per month and allows you to monitor remaining credits in your dashboard, upgrade your plan if you run low, or import larger batches of content when you know your credit allowance will cover it.
Can I use Pin Generator with my Etsy or Shopify store?
Yes, Pin Generator connects directly to your Etsy and Shopify stores to import products, product images, and descriptions, then turns them into ready‑made Pinterest pins. You can map product fields to pin templates, generate multiple pins per product, and schedule those pins to promote your listings or products over time without manual design work.
Does Pin Generator support scheduling pins on Pinterest?
Yes, Pin Generator lets you schedule pins across multiple boards and time slots, distributing them automatically so you maintain a steady posting schedule. You can set up recurring schedules, choose preferred posting times, and let the system queue pins for you while still monitoring what is scheduled and when it will publish.
How does the AI writer feature work?
The AI writer analyzes your source content or product data and suggests optimized titles, descriptions, and hashtags tailored to Pinterest SEO and engagement. You can accept the suggestions as‑is, tweak them, or regenerate multiple variants to test different copy styles across your pin library.
Can I customize pin templates for my brand?
Yes, the template builder lets you create and save custom pin layouts with your brand fonts, colors, logo placements, and image guidelines. Those templates can then be reused across all your pins, ensuring that every pin you generate maintains a consistent look and feel aligned with your brand identity.
Is there a free trial or free plan?
Pin Generator offers both a limited free tier and a short‑term free trial that lets you test pin generation, templates, and basic scheduling without immediate payment. The free trial typically includes a generous set of credits and access to core features, after which you can decide whether to upgrade to a paid plan that matches your expected volume.
Can multiple people use one Pin Generator account?
A single account can manage multiple Pinterest profiles and campaigns, making it suitable for small teams or agencies that want to coordinate several brands or clients under one subscription. However, strict user‑seat limits may apply on certain plans, so higher‑tier or agency plans are recommended if you need dedicated logins and role‑based access.
Does Pin Generator work with RSS feeds?
Yes, Pin Generator can pull new content from RSS or Atom feeds and automatically turn newly published posts into Pinterest pins using your saved templates. This lets you maintain a continuous flow of pins from your blog or newsletter without manually adding every article each time.
How does Pin Generator handle keyword research and trends?
The platform includes a keyword research tool that suggests relevant Pinterest‑friendly keywords and phrases based on your content or product category, plus trend alerts that highlight rising topics or seasonal spikes. You can use these insights to refine your pin titles, descriptions, and hashtags so your pins are more likely to surface in search and category feeds.
